Bug 11512: Update syspref description
[koha.git] / koha-tmpl / intranet-tmpl / prog / en / modules / admin / audio_alerts.tt
1 [% USE Koha %]
2 [% SET footerjs = 1 %]
3 [% INCLUDE 'doc-head-open.inc' %]
4 <title>Koha &rsaquo; Administration &rsaquo; Audio alerts</title>
5 [% INCLUDE 'doc-head-close.inc' %]
6 </head>
7
8 <body id="admin_audio_alerts" class="admin">
9 [% INCLUDE 'header.inc' %]
10 [% INCLUDE 'prefs-admin-search.inc' %]
11
12 <div id="breadcrumbs"><a href="/cgi-bin/koha/mainpage.pl">Home</a> &rsaquo; <a href="/cgi-bin/koha/admin/admin-home.pl">Administration</a> &rsaquo; Audio alerts</div>
13
14 <div id="doc3" class="yui-t2">
15     <div id="bd">
16         <div id="yui-main">
17             <div class="yui-b">
18
19                 <div id="toolbar" class="btn-toolbar">
20                     <a class="btn btn-default btn-sm" id="newalert" href="/cgi-bin/koha/admin/audio_alerts.pl"><i class="fa fa-plus"></i> New alert</a>
21                 </div>
22
23                 <form id="new-alert-form" action="audio_alerts.pl" method="post" class="validated">
24                     <fieldset class="rows">
25                         <legend><span class="create-alert">Add new alert</span><span class="edit-alert">Edit alert</span></legend>
26
27                         <input id="id" name="id" type="hidden" value="" />
28                         <ol>
29                             <li>
30                                 <label for="selector" class="required">Selector: </label>
31                                 <input id="selector" name="selector" type="text" class="required input-large" placeholder="selector" />
32                                 <span class="required">Required</span>
33                             </li>
34                             <li>
35                                 <label for="sound" class="required">Sound: </label>
36                                 <input id="sound" name="sound" type="text" class="required input-large" placeholder="sound" />
37                                 <button id="play-sound" class="btn btn-default btn-xs disabled"><i class="fa fa-play"></i> Play sound</button>
38                                  <span class="required">Required</span>
39                             </li>
40                             <li>
41                                 <label for="koha-sounds">Select a built-in sound: </label>
42                                 <select id="koha-sounds">
43                                     <option value=""> -- Choose one -- </option>
44                                     <option value="beep.ogg">beep.ogg</option>
45                                     <option value="call.ogg">call.ogg</option>
46                                     <option value="critical.ogg">critical.ogg</option>
47                                     <option value="device_connect.ogg">device_connect.ogg</option>
48                                     <option value="device_disconnect.ogg">device_disconnect.ogg</option>
49                                     <option value="ending.ogg">ending.ogg</option>
50                                     <option value="fail.ogg">fail.ogg</option>
51                                     <option value="IM_notification.ogg">IM_notification.ogg</option>
52                                     <option value="incoming_call.ogg">incoming_call.ogg</option>
53                                     <option value="loading.ogg">loading.ogg</option>
54                                     <option value="loading_2.ogg">loading_2.ogg</option>
55                                     <option value="maximize.ogg">maximize.ogg</option>
56                                     <option value="minimize.ogg">minimize.ogg</option>
57                                     <option value="new_mail_notification.ogg">new_mail_notification.ogg</option>
58                                     <option value="opening.ogg">opening.ogg</option>
59                                     <option value="panic.ogg">panic.ogg</option>
60                                     <option value="popup.ogg">popup.ogg</option>
61                                     <option value="warning.ogg">warning.ogg</option>
62                                 </select>
63                             </li>
64                         </ol>
65                     </fieldset>
66                     <fieldset class="action">
67                             <input id="save-alert" type="submit" value="Submit" />
68                             <a href="#" id="cancel-edit" class="cancel cancel-edit">Cancel</a>
69                     </fieldset>
70                 </form>
71
72                 <form id="delete-alert-form" action="audio_alerts.pl" method="post">
73                     <h3>Audio alerts</h3>
74                     [%IF !( Koha.Preference('AudioAlerts') ) %]
75                         <div class="dialog alert">
76                             <p><strong>Note: </strong></p>
77                             <p>Please enable system preference 'AudioAlerts' to activate sounds.</p>
78                         </div>
79                     [% END %]
80                     <table id="audio-alerts-table">
81                         <thead id="audio-alerts-table-head">
82                             <tr>
83                                 <th>&nbsp;</th>
84                                 <th>Precedence</th>
85                                 <th>Change order</th>
86                                 <th>Selector</th>
87                                 <th>Sound</th>
88                                 <th>&nbsp;</th>
89                             </tr>
90                         </thead>
91
92                         <tbody id="audio-alerts-table-body">
93                             [% FOREACH a IN audio_alerts %]
94                                 <tr>
95                                     <td><input type="checkbox" name="delete" value="[% a.id %]" /></td>
96                                     <td>[% a.precedence %]</td>
97                                     <td style="white-space:nowrap;">
98                                         <a title="Move alert up" href="audio_alerts.pl?action=move&amp;where=up&amp;id=[% a.id %]">
99                                             <i class="fa fa-arrow-up fa-lg order-control"></i>
100                                         </a>
101
102                                         <a title="Move alert to top" href="audio_alerts.pl?action=move&amp;where=top&amp;id=[% a.id %]">
103                                             <i class="fa fa-arrow-up fa-lg overline order-control"></i>
104                                         </a>
105
106                                         <a title="Move alert to bottom" href="audio_alerts.pl?action=move&amp;where=bottom&amp;id=[% a.id %]">
107                                             <i class="fa fa-arrow-down fa-lg underline order-control"></i>
108                                         </a>
109
110                                         <a title="Move alert down" href="audio_alerts.pl?action=move&amp;where=down&amp;id=[% a.id %]">
111                                             <i class="fa fa-arrow-down fa-lg order-control"></i>
112                                         </a>
113                                     </td>
114                                     <td>[% a.selector %]</td>
115                                     <td>[% a.sound %]</td>
116                                     <td>
117                                         <a class="btn btn-default btn-xs edit" data-soundid="[% a.id %]" data-precedence="[% a.precedence %]" data-selector="[% a.selector %]" data-sound="[% a.sound %]"><i class="fa fa-pencil"></i> Edit</a></td>
118                                 </tr>
119                             [% END %]
120                         </tbody>
121                     </table>
122
123                     <p>
124                         <button id="delete-alerts" type="submit" class="btn btn-default btn-sm disabled"><i class="fa fa-trash"></i> Delete selected alerts</button>
125                     </p>
126                 </form>
127             </div>
128         </div>
129     <div class="yui-b">
130 [% INCLUDE 'admin-menu.inc' %]
131 </div>
132 </div>
133
134 [% MACRO jsinclude BLOCK %]
135     <script type="text/javascript" src="[% interface %]/[% theme %]/js/admin-menu_[% KOHA_VERSION %].js"></script>
136     <script type="text/javascript">
137         var MSG_AUDIO_EMPTY_SOUND = _("Please select or enter a sound.");
138         var MSG_AUDIO_CONFIRM_DELETE = _("Are you sure you want to delete the selected audio alerts?");
139         var MSG_AUDIO_CHECK_CHECKBOXES = _("Check the box next to the alert you want to delete.")
140     </script>
141     <script type="text/javascript" src="[% interface %]/[% theme %]/js/audio_alerts_[% KOHA_VERSION %].js"></script>
142 [% END %]
143 [% INCLUDE 'intranet-bottom.inc' %]